实时更新-0428-Windows全息版MOD制作详解与体感交互体验教程
实时更新-0428-MOD制作教程-Windows全息版-体感交互
各位手游玩家和MOD爱好者们注意啦!今天咱们要聊的可是个硬核话题——如何用Windows全息版搞出带体感交互的MOD,还能实时更新!听起来像科幻片?别慌,这篇教程手把手教你从零开始,保证看完就能上手操作,废话不多说,咱们直接开整!
MOD制作教程:从菜鸟到大神的必经之路
先给新手朋友科普一下,MOD(Modification)就是游戏模组,简单说就是给原版游戏“打补丁”,改玩法、加道具、换皮肤甚至彻底重构剧情,我的世界》里那些神仙建筑,八成都是MOD的功劳,但今天咱们要搞的可不是普通MOD,而是结合了全息投影和体感交互的“黑科技版”!
准备工作:工具选对,事半功倍
- 开发环境:Windows全息版系统(别告诉我你还在用Win7!全息版对AR/VR支持更好)
- 核心工具:Unity或Unreal Engine(推荐Unity,资源多上手快)
- 体感设备:Kinect、Leap Motion或者手机摄像头(土豪可以直接上Hololens 2)
- 代码辅助:Visual Studio(装好C#插件,别问我为啥,问就是Unity亲爹)
小贴士:如果电脑配置拉胯,建议先关掉所有后台程序,MOD制作可是吃内存的大户!
基础MOD结构拆解
一个标准MOD包含三个核心部分:
- 资源包(贴图、模型、音效)
- 脚本文件(控制逻辑,按E键开宝箱”)
- 配置文件(告诉游戏“这个MOD该加载到哪个位置”)
举个例子:你想在《原神》里加个“全息传送门”,需要先做个3D模型(用Blender就行),然后写脚本让玩家触碰传送门时切换场景,最后在配置文件里指定传送门出现在蒙德城广场。
实时更新黑科技
传统MOD更新得重新下载安装包,但咱们要玩点高级的——热更新!原理很简单:把核心逻辑写在云端脚本里,玩家每次启动MOD时自动下载最新版本。
操作步骤:
- 在GitHub或Gitee建个私密仓库,放你的MOD代码
- 用Unity的AssetBundle打包资源,设置成“每次启动检查更新”
- 写个简单的HTTP请求脚本,检测到新版本就自动下载替换
避坑指南:记得给代码加版本号,不然玩家可能卡在旧版本无限循环!
Windows全息版:把游戏装进空气里
全息投影不是魔法,但用对了能让你MOD逼格直接拉满!Windows全息版的核心是Holographic Remoting技术,简单说就是让电脑把画面投到空气中,还能用手势互动。
全息MOD开发三步走
- 场景搭建:在Unity里新建一个“Holographic Scene”,把3D模型拖进去
- 空间映射:用HoloToolkit的Spatial Mapping组件,让MOD能识别现实中的桌子、椅子
- 交互设计:设置“空气点击”手势,比如捏合手指触发技能
进阶技巧:想让MOD更真实?试试给模型加物理引擎!比如让全息宝箱能被现实中的书本砸飞(别问我怎么知道的,试过就知道多好玩)。
全息MOD实战案例
假设我们要给《和平精英》做个全息空投箱:
- 用3D Max建模一个发光的箱子,贴图要带全息网格特效
- 写脚本让箱子每隔10分钟随机刷新在玩家周围5米内
- 通过Kinect识别玩家手势,挥手就能打开空投(再也不用蹲在地上捡装备了!)
效果演示:当玩家走进房间,空投箱突然“悬浮”在茶几上方,伸手虚抓一下,装备哗啦啦掉出来——这体验,隔壁小孩都馋哭了!
体感交互:甩掉键盘鼠标,用身体玩游戏
体感交互才是MOD的灵魂!想想看,用挥拳代替点鼠标,用跳跃代替按空格,这代入感直接爆表。
体感设备选型指南
- 平民版:手机摄像头+AI姿势识别(免费,但延迟高)
- 进阶版:Kinect体感器(200块左右,微软亲儿子)
- 土豪版:Vive Tracker(精准到手指关节,但贵得离谱)
性价比之选:Kinect二代,二手市场300块能搞定,还能同时追踪6个人体关节点,跳个极乐净土MOD完全没问题。
体感脚本编写攻略
以Unity为例,核心代码就三步:
- 引入Kinect SDK包(微软官网免费下载)
- 写个“BodySourceView”脚本,实时获取玩家骨骼数据
- 设置触发条件,当右手高于肩膀时发射子弹”
调试技巧:在Scene窗口打开骨骼预览,看着小人跳舞调参数,比闷头写代码有趣多了!
体感MOD创意脑洞
- 格斗游戏MOD:用拳打脚踢代替按键组合,打出一套“升龙拳”全息特效
- 音游MOD:跟着节奏挥手砍方块,错拍的话全息地板会裂开(社死预警)
- 恐怖游戏MOD:突然有鬼从背后扑来,你得真·转身才能逃跑
警告:玩体感MOD记得清空周围障碍物,别问我为什么知道——上次为了躲全息僵尸,我直接撞翻了显示器。
实时更新+全息+体感:三合一终极MOD
现在把前面学的东西打包起来,做个能实时更新、带全息投影和体感交互的MOD!
架构设计
- 云端层:用AWS或阿里云托管MOD资源和脚本
- 本地层:Windows全息版负责渲染,Kinect处理体感输入
- 通信层:WebSocket实时推送更新,延迟控制在100ms以内
优化点:用Protobuf代替JSON传输数据,体积小还解压快,手机热点都能流畅更新。
实战案例:全息版《宝可梦GO》
- 全息捕捉:宝可梦以3D形象“漂浮”在现实场景中,得走上前才能对战
- 体感战斗:扔精灵球要真的做投掷动作,躲技能需要侧身闪避
- 实时更新:每周限时活动自动推送,周末全天候闪电鸟出没”
玩家反馈:“以前低头抓宝可梦,现在满大街找全息怪,邻居都以为我在练功!”
常见问题Q&A
Q:MOD会被官方封号吗?
A:单机MOD随便玩,联机MOD别改数值(比如无限金币),联机作弊容易秋后算账。
Q:全息投影伤眼睛吗?
A:控制使用时间,每次别超过1小时,记得开护眼模式。
Q:体感交互延迟怎么解决?
A:关掉所有后台进程,Kinect插USB3.0接口,实在不行换固态硬盘。
MOD的未来是“全感体验”
从键鼠到触屏,再到体感+全息,游戏交互一直在突破维度,现在花点时间学MOD制作,说不定你就是下一个改变游戏规则的人!最后送大家一句话:“MOD的尽头不是修改游戏,而是创造新世界”,赶紧打开电脑,咱们全息战场见!